The cheapest way to get from Bristol to Wembley Park is to bus which costs £18 - £60 and takes 3h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Bristol to Wembley Park is to train which takes 1h 59m and costs £60 - £130.
No, there is no direct bus from Bristol station to Wembley Park station.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at Harrow Bus Station via Heathrow Central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 23m.
No, there is no direct train from Bristol to Wembley Park station. However, there are services departing from Bristol Temple Meads and arriving at Wembley Park station via Paddington station and Baker Street station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 59m.
The distance between Bristol and Wembley Park is 126 miles. The road distance is 114.6 miles.
The best way to get from Bristol to Wembley Park without a car is to train which takes 1h 59m and costs £60 - £130.
It takes approximately 1h 59m to get from Bristol to Wembley Park, including transfers.
Bristol to Wembley Park b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Bus Station.
Bristol to Wembley Park train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), depart from Bristol Temple Meads station.
The best way to get from Bristol to Wembley Park is to train which takes 1h 59m and costs £60 - £130. Alternatively, you can bus via Heathrow Central Bus Station, which costs £24 - £65 and takes 3h 23m.
